Question 497: To ask the Minister for Enterprise, Trade and Employment to confirm his plans to make an official visit to Ukraine, to promote trade links between the two countries;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[28885/05]

Planning of a ministerial trade mission from Ireland to the Ukraine is under way and it is hoped the timing of the mission, probably early 2006, will be finalised in the near future. This initiative follows a seminar organised by Enterprise Ireland in June last on doing business in the Ukraine which was extremely well attended. The proposed trade mission will act as focus for existing Irish interest in Ukraine and attract other Irish companies wishing to enter the Ukrainian market. The Ukraine is one of Europe's fastest growing economies and several sectors are especially interesting to Irish companies, for example, telecommunications, technology transfer, software, the food sector, healthcare, pharmaceuticals-medical devices, international consulting services, automotive components and aviation services.
